The Street does not spark a lot of interest on The site but the forum is about passing on what we done and learned. The bags are working . But as you see in the picture they stand out from the bike a lot. That is due to universal mounts. As I was looking at solving this this morning a simple answer came. Just flip the brackets end for end. Swapped out 4 bolts for some shorter ones and done. In the is picture you see the difference the right side in done the left not. I could still get another 1/2 to 3/4 with a minor minor bit of work.
